    Talk about not standing behind your products. Bought a new pair of boots and the pull tab wore out after a couple dozen wears and popped right off. It was obviously poor manufacturing; doesn't make sense that on one boot it's totally intact and on the other it's fraying.I emailed them because I figured a boot shouldn't have pieces coming off after 18 weeks. *******, the General Manager who also apparently handles customer service, told me it was due to stress and wear and that I should have been using a shoe horn. He also got personal once I mentioned posting on a cobblers forum and told me I seemed like someone who would be upset no matter how old the boots were, implying that I'm unreasonable for not liking that my almost new boots are falling apart. This guy talks about his 42 years of experience like he's some authority but apparently doesn't understand that people pull on a pull tab.I spoke with some cobblers and they told me that many companies like To Boot New York have gotten lazy and cheap out on these sorts of things, no longer viewing them as functional pieces. They agreed that it's ridiculous to ask customers not to pull on a pull tab or to use a shoe horn as an excuse for the cheap construction.My local shoe repair is going to fix this for me and do it better so they don't come off again.I'm shocked that To Boot had such little regard for the customer experience. I enjoyed the boots other than this and might have purchased more. Maybe they could have offered a nominal refund to help offset the repair? Not sure, but anyone with a customer service bone in their body could have come up with some better response than what I got.Do not recommend!
